Understanding San Francisco's Weather Patterns

San Francisco's Mediterranean climate brings mild, wet winters and dry summers. However, several factors influence the city's weather, including: — Francis Mercier: Los Angeles Concert!

  • Fog: The city is famous for its fog, often called "Karl the Fog," which is most common during the summer months. The fog forms when warm, moist air from the Pacific Ocean meets the cold California Current.
  • Microclimates: San Francisco's diverse topography creates distinct microclimates. Hills, valleys, and proximity to the ocean all play a role in shaping local weather conditions.
  • Seasonal Changes: While summer is typically dry, fall can often be the warmest time of year. Winter brings rain and occasional strong storms.

Tips for Staying Comfortable in San Francisco

Given the variable weather, here are some tips to ensure you're prepared:

  1. Dress in Layers: This allows you to adjust to changing temperatures throughout the day.
  2. Carry a Jacket: Even on sunny days, the fog can roll in quickly, bringing a chill.
